Top 5 Communication Apps on Android in Colombia Q3 2025
Discover the performance trends of the leading communication apps on Android in Colombia during Q3 2025, with insights from Sensor Tower.
In the third quarter of 2025, the performance of the top communication apps on the Android platform in Colombia showed interesting trends. According to Sensor Tower data, these apps displayed diverse patterns in downloads, revenue, and active user engagement.
WhatsApp Messenger consistently led the pack with weekly downloads peaking at around 178K in early August. Active users remained stable, hovering around 24.5M throughout the quarter. Revenue, however, was negligible, maintaining a zero mark for most of the period.
Telegram experienced a steady increase in revenue, reaching approximately $7.6K in early September. Downloads fluctuated, peaking at 175K in the second week of September. Active users hit a high of about 10.3M during the same period, reflecting a growing user base.
WhatsApp Business saw a gradual rise in revenue, culminating at $6.7K by the end of September. Downloads climbed steadily, reaching 129K in the last week of the quarter. Active users showed a slight decline, settling at around 9.3M.
CallApp: Caller ID & Block maintained a stable revenue stream, ending with $3.3K in late September. Downloads saw a peak of 95K in late August, while active users remained steady, with a slight increase to 4.4M.
Truecaller: Spam Call Blocker ended the quarter with a notable revenue increase, reaching $9.9K. Downloads fluctuated, peaking at 98K in early August. Active users consistently grew, reaching nearly 9.8M by the end of September.
